The Proclamation of 1763 was issued by the British government, aimed at preventing colonists from settling on lands acquired from Native Americans after the French and Indian War. It was intended to reduce conflicts with Native Americans and stabilize the frontier. However, this measure was widely ignored by settlers who continued to move westward.
